‎Massive Turnout as Ipetu Ijesa host Aropeju Week Cultural Day Celebration yesterday, full with free foods ‎

Published by on October 31st, 2025.


‎Massive Turnout as Ipetu Ijesa host Aropeju Week Cultural Day Celebration yesterday, full with free foods

‎The annual Aropeju Week of Ipetu Ijesa indigenes, both at home and abroad, was celebrated with great joy and togetherness. The Cultural Day, held on Thursday, October 30th, witnessed a massive turnout of people who came to honour and celebrate the town’s rich heritage. The event was filled with colourful displays of traditional attire, music, and dance performances that showcased the beauty of Ipetu Ijesa culture. The people attended in large numbers, expressing happiness and pride in their traditions. It was a memorable day that strengthened unity and reminded everyone of the importance of preserving their roots.

‎The King of Ipetu Ijesa Kingdom, Oba Dr. Barr. Agunbiade Samson Adeleke, the Ajalaye of Ipetu Ijesa, graced the occasion and spoke passionately about the value of culture and language. He noted that when a tribe begins to lose its language, it also starts to lose its identity. Barr. Oluwole also emphasized that culture plays a vital role in shaping the laws and traditions of the people. To make the event more lively, a quiz and debate competition were held to test participants’ knowledge about great men and women whose contributions have helped the growth and development of Ipetu Ijesa.

‎The celebration was well attended by dignitaries, including the chiefs of Ipetu Ijesa, representatives of the Nigeria Union of Teachers (NUT), Comr. Folly, Prof. Adedeji Adebayo, and Bolaji Oladeji. Guests were also treated to a variety of traditional Ipetu Ijesa delicacies such as Kango, Monmon, Abari, and others. The Cultural Day was truly a highlight of Aropeju Week, celebrating unity, joy, and the proud identity of the Ipetu Ijesa people.
